Overseeing Avian Efficiency and Survivorship at the Assateague Area
The fresh Institute to own Bird Communities (IBP) developed the Overseeing Avian Yields and Survivorship (MAPS) program to explore reasons for inhabitants declines, the results regarding climate changes, in order to find where conservation demands are essential. The initial Charts station began functioning inside the 1989, plus in 2024 you’ll find over step one,2 hundred programs along side Us and you will Canda.
Assateague Area Federal Coastline (ASIS) depending good Maps Station in 2022 to higher comprehend the fitness regarding coastal forest bird communities with the Assateague Isle. That it investment will give details about reproductive success of reproduction passerines (songbirds) in the coastal loblolly pine forest. Maritime woods on burden isles give a unique environment to have animals however they are up against of several dangers from the water-level increase and you may decimating pests.
1 day in the Banding Station
A great Maps bird bander’s time starts a few hours just before start. Given that sunrays is rising from the loblolly pines, i open 10 mist nets pass on uniformly throughout our very own 20-acre tree. Forty moments afterwards, it’s about time with the first online focus on. We very carefully glance at for each and every online to have entangled birds, and you may extract those who have been caught. Immediately after from the banding station, we shall make bird’s weight, then lay a tiny material ring on bird’s feet. Per ring has actually a different sort of amount that allows each bird getting in person known. This provides you with banders to the chance to discover when and where the fresh new bird was first banded, along with evaluate analysis when brand new bird try grabbed. Next, we list looks characteristics and you can measurements and help us dictate the new ages and you will sex of your bird. When we check if i have collected all the compatible research, we launch brand new bird unharmed. Shortly after half a dozen days off net works and you may banding, we personal new nets and you can finish off the fresh banding station. I will be back for the next banding course in about ten months.
Findings immediately following 3 years from Banding
During the period of three years, you will find grabbed and you will banded 535 private wild birds representing 39 types. From inside the 2022, we banded 182 individuals representing 31 species. I trapped twenty-eight Family Wrens and you can eleven Carolina Wrens getting back together by far the most abundant loved ones (Profile step 1). In 2023, i banded a maximum of 218 people representing 29 types. We caught 65 Gray Catbirds (Mimidae) and this stands for the most abundant family unit members (Contour 2). When you look at the 2024, i banded a maximum of 135 someone representing twenty five kinds. More plentiful family relations was the wrens (Troglodytidae) that have 38 House Wrens and 16 Carolina Wrens.
New wrens (Family Wrens and Carolina Wrens) had been more numerous members of the family into the 2022. The newest Catbirds (Gray Catbird) was basically one particular rich in 2023. The fresh wrens (Domestic Wren and you may Carolina Wren) was in fact by far the most abundant family members when you look at the 2024.
- In the 2023, i caught accurate documentation amount of 24 private warblers (Parulidae) representing 7 different types.

Wild birds once the Bioindicators
Park professionals acknowledge the necessity of reading environment health for the an excellent active environment such as for instance a boundary isle. The brand new NPS Collection and you can Overseeing Program (for Assateague Island, the brand new Northeast Coastal and you will Burden Circle) performs enough time-name environmental overseeing to provide worthwhile analysis so you’re able to playground professionals and you can the general public. One to important signal that is identified was tree health, with tree framework, structure and you will animals fictional character (NPS 2024). Their cluster out of boffins had been surveying founded long-title overseeing plots of land about . As bird range and you can populace personality was bioindicators out of tree health (Drever & ), park managers additional this new Maps system to enhance their experience in the latest maritime tree ecosystem.
You will find several forest obligate species one to reproduce at the ASIS including given that Oak Warbler and the East Wood-Pewee. Such wild birds trust a healthy forest environment time after time to efficiently replicate. For this reason, the info from the Charts route plus the Northeast Coastal and you may Burden Circle are fantastic barometers for facts Assateague Island’s tree wellness thanks to day.
